    Mine ran hot & I was terrified of overheating her for reasons unrelated to being a FTM.

    We ended up co-sleeping because I'd pass out while nursing her at night, though we eventually transitioned to a bassinet in our bedroom and then the crib 'til she was 6 months old and got her first cold.

    One of the things that helped when it got cooler was putting a flannel sheet on her mattress.

    BabyBearsMom upthread suggested the PBK chamois sheets, but I bought these: http://www.amazon.com/Tadpoles-Organ...nel+crib+sheet

    3 years later, they are still in good shape ... but my daughter rarely slept on them!
